			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div style="text-align: center;"><strong><span style="font-size: 14px; font-family: Trebuchet MS;">Big guys don&#8217;t give away their clothes.<br />
 <br />
</span></strong></p>
<div style="text-align: left;">Goodwill, Salvation Army, &amp; Savers are cool places, but don&#8217;t go there expecting to find a ton of big guy clothes.  It&#8217;s been my experience that when it comes to big man clothes @ second-hand shops&#8230; they&#8217;re pretty much non-existent.  I don&#8217;t think it&#8217;s because fat people are stingy or hoarders.  I think they&#8217;re strategic and realistic.  </p>
<p>This is my theory&#8230; There isn&#8217;t much plus-size clothing @ Goodwill because big guys keep all their clothes!</p>
<p>I&#8217;m not entirely sure why we don&#8217;t donate old clothes to second-hand shops, but I&#8217;m thinking it&#8217;s because  we like to have a collection of clothes in each size.  Personally, my weight fluctuates so I seriously have clothes in a few different sizes. </p>
<ul>
<li>If I lose weight, I like to keep the bigger clothes &#8211; just in case I re-gain the pounds.</li>
<li>If I gain weight, you know I&#8217;m keep the clothes&#8230; cause I&#8217;m determined to fit back in them one day.</li>
</ul>
<p>Also, I think a major factor is how expensive our clothes are.  When I pay $30 for a shirt.. I don&#8217;t want to just give that away. Even if it doesn&#8217;t fit right or is getting old. </p>
<p>Now, don&#8217;t get me wrong.  I donate old clothes&#8230; just not that often.  I have a closet full of stuff I don&#8217;t wear, but hope to one day fit in them again!</p>
<p>This is just my theory. Anyone else have any ideas as to why there is a lack of Big &amp; Tall clothing at Goodwill?</p></div>
